π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

Grease 12 muffin cups or line with paper muffin liners.

Place 1 cup rolled oats in a food processor and process until ground.

In a large bowl, combine ground oats with flour, 1 tablespoon rolled oats, chopped walnuts, baking powder, cinnamon and salt.

In a separate b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y.

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the banana and vanilla.

Stir in sour cream.

Mix oat/flour mixture into egg mixture.

Spoon batter into prepared muffin pans.

To make Topping: In a small bowl, combine 1/3 cup rolled oats, brown sugar, cinnamon.

Cut in butter until mixture resembles coarse crumbs; stir in 1/4 cup chopped walnuts.

Generously sprinkle muffins with topping.

Bake in pre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es, until golden brown and a toothpick inserted into a muffin comes out clean.
